摘要
分析了基于进程代数的软件体系结构模型的安全性,将相容性检查和互操作性检查从单个软件体系结构推广到不同风格的体系结构风格,扩展基于进程代数的软件体系结构描述语言,通过顺序进程代数项族和预定义的体系结构类型调用对软件体系结构安全建模。通过一个例子介绍了这种建模方法。
On the basis of analyzing the security of software architecture model based on process algebra, compatibility check and interoperability check were extended from single software architectures to architectural styles, and software architecture description language was expanded. Software architecture can be modeled not only through a family of sequential process algebras terms, but also through an invocation of a previously defined architectural type. This method was introduced through an example.
